计算机ida是什么

时间:2025-01-17 17:46:39 单机攻略

计算机中的IDA是 交互式反汇编器专业版(Interactive Disassembler Professional)的简称,通常简称为IDA。它是一款由Hex-Rays公司开发的强大静态反编译软件,广泛应用于软件安全、计算机安全和程序逆向工程领域。

IDA的主要功能包括:

交互式反汇编:

将机器语言转换成人类可读的汇编语言形式,并通过交互界面辅助分析程序的结构和行为。

源代码级别浏览:

具备源代码级别的浏览功能,帮助用户理解程序的运行逻辑。

高级分析功能:

支持符号执行、逻辑推理和图形分析等高级分析手段。

多处理器支持:

能够分析多处理器的程序。

跨平台支持:

支持Windows、Linux、WinCE和MacOS等多种操作系统平台。

广泛的应用领域:

适用于安全研究、恶意代码分析和漏洞挖掘等。

IDA因其强大的功能和广泛的应用,被公认为最好的逆向工程工具之一,深受0day世界的成员和ShellCode安全分析人士的青睐。